A G E N D A

 

HB 57

Status

RELATING TO GOVERNMENT SERVICES.

Clarifies the office of the legislative analyst.

 

LMG, FIN

HB 205

Status

RELATING TO DISCLOSURE OF ATTORNEY-CLIENT AND ATTORNEY WORK­ PRODUCT PRIVILEGED COMMUNICATIONS TO THE OMBUDSMAN.

Specifies that disclosure of communications by an agency to the ombudsman does not waive any existing attorney-client or attorney work-product privilege pertaining to those communications.  Prohibits the ombudsman from disclosing privileged communications to others.

 

LMG, JHA, FIN

HB 513

Status

RELATING TO THE STATE CAPITOL MANAGEMENT COMMITTEE.

Dissolves the state capitol management committee.

 

LMG, FIN

HB 517

Status

RELATING TO THE AUDITOR.

Clarifies that the state auditor may examine all accounts and records of any other State department, agency, or division notwithstanding any law to the contrary.

 

LMG, JHA, FIN
